682063
00000000000000000004389d6de36f126eb119b2f215a2bb75cbc716a055cff0
Time
05-05-2021 21:00:13 (Local)
Sponsored
Transaction Fees
0.00397059
BTC
Confirmations
228502
Total Amounts
40619.11617614 USDT
Transaction Counts
17
Previous Block:
Merkle Root:
605ba18608f981d47df71dae1b8d55fcd313d348d2c4bea59730ba242aa3aff3